Philippine Army Awards Operation Blessing as NGO of the Year

The Philippine Army recently awarded Operation Blessing (OB) as Non-Government Organization (NGO) of the Year for 2007, for its efforts in promoting peace and nation-building in impoverished provinces in the country.

OB Distributes Free Wheelchairs to Handicapped Comvaleños
Thursday, 04 February 2010 05:26

http://cbnasia.org/images/obwebsite_images/OB Distributes Free Wheelchairs to Handicapped Comvaleños NABUNTURAN, Compostela Valley — Operation Blessing Foundation Philippines (OB) distributed free wheelchairs to impoverished Comvaleños with walking disabilities. The distribution was done last Thursday, January 28, in partnership with Sacred Harvest Foundation, Free Wheelchair Mission, and Adventist Development and Relief Agency.

2007 | Quick Facts
Over 28,000 sick people were treated and cared for in 112 medical missions across the Philippines.

Emergency aid was rushed to more than 17,700 people in places badly affected by various forms of calamities

948 families are now able to begin better lives through livelihood grants given to them by OB

Close to 49,000 nutritious meals were served to feed undernourished children

169 fresh water wells were drilled in provinces where clean drinking water remains a major concern

Free wheelchairs were given to 1,044 persons with disabilities in many of the poorest regions in the country

383 out-of-school youth and jobless adults were trained in various skills to begin decent jobs
